🧠 “Wait, So What Is Repurposing Exactly?”
Think of repurposing like leftovers… but make it gourmet.
Let’s say you wrote a 10-minute article on “How to Start a Podcast.” That same article could turn into:
- 3 quote graphics
- 5 tweet threads
- 1 spicy opinionated LinkedIn post
- 2 Instagram carousel slideshows
- 1 TikTok script (maybe with a filter, if you’re feeling fancy)
- A Pinterest pin, if you’re feeling brave
All from ONE piece of content.

🔧 The AI Tools You’ll Want In Your Repurposing Toolkit
Let’s break this down like a 90s mix CD:
1. ChatGPT (obviously)
Use it to summarize, paraphrase, reframe, and spin content into new formats. Try this prompt:
“Summarize this 1500-word blog post into 5 Instagram carousel ideas. Keep it casual, slightly witty, and speak to beginner creators.”
💡Pro Tip: Give it tone cues like “friendly but sarcastic” or “wise millennial friend energy.”
2. Notion AI or Google Gemini
Perfect for turning bullet points into paragraphs (or vice versa). Also great if you’re someone who thinks in outlines.
“Here’s a podcast episode transcript. Turn this into a LinkedIn post with a story-hook start.”
Watch it go.
3. Descript
If your content is in video or podcast form, Descript will transcribe it and let you chop it up into golden snippets. You can literally highlight a sentence and export it as a Reel.
4. Canva Magic Write + Magic Design
Once you’ve got the copy, Canva’s AI can help you whip it into social-ready designs. And the best part? No design degree required.
5. Typeframes or Pictory
Video AI tools that take your blog or transcript and turn them into short, snackable videos. Add voiceover, trending music, a little sparkle, and voilà—you’ve got TikTok content.
🧪 Real-World Example: Repurposing in Action
Let’s walk through a real (and slightly chaotic) example.
Imagine this: You hosted a live webinar called “How to Attract Clients Without Cold DMs”. The replay is 40 minutes long. Normally, you’d post it on YouTube and move on. But now?
Here’s what we’re doing instead:
➡️ Step 1: Transcribe it with Descript
Export it into a document. No need to watch yourself talk again. (Cringe be gone.)
➡️ Step 2: Use ChatGPT to summarize key points
Prompt:
“Summarize this into 7 bite-sized lessons for Instagram carousels.”
Now you’ve got your weekly posts—each one a golden nugget.
➡️ Step 3: Extract spicy one-liners
Use this prompt:
“Pull out 10 bold statements or quotable insights from this webinar.”
Boom. You’ve got tweet content, quote graphics, and hooks.
➡️ Step 4: Script a short-form video
Prompt:
“Turn this section into a 30-second TikTok script with a hook, one big idea, and a strong CTA.”
Now record that bad boy on your phone and toss in a trending audio.

🧁 Some Quick & Dirty Repurposing Prompts You Can Steal Right Now
Use these with your AI tool of choice:
- “Summarize this podcast into 5 tweet threads with hooks.”
- “Rewrite this blog intro for a casual Instagram Reel script.”
- “Pull out 3 statistics or facts I can use as carousel headlines.”
- “Turn this article into a humorous LinkedIn post for freelance designers.”
- “Extract 3 emotional stories from this long-form piece that would work on TikTok.”
